Forest Hills Haven, An Oasis Between Rock Creek Park And Bustling Downtown DC
Enjoy the perfect location of this DC 1 bedroom apt situation between Rock Creek Park and only minutes walking to 2 red line metro lines - Cleveland Park and Van Ness. Walking distance to cafes, restaurants, shops, the local movie theater and all you could need, this private apartment offers all the modern amenities close to downtown DC.
Included in the newly renovated space is a queen bed, modern kitchen with dishwasher, cable TV, internet, washer/dryer, a fully stocked kitchen and a sofa bed which sleeps two children or one adult, comfortably. Two separate front and back entrances make this private oasis near the park perfect for relaxing after long days.
Should you need recommendations or anything, we live in the house above and are happy to make your stay comfortable. For extra, there is a private parking space.
